Phone number βοΈ 01217900772 π is reported as a persistent nuisance number mostly linked with scam calls. Callers often claim to represent well-known companies like BT, EDF or various utility providers, but their behaviour is rude, pushy and sometimes aggressive. They frequently hang up abruptly or refuse to provide information by email as requested. Numerous users suspect itβs a scam targeting business or home services, with calls sometimes in different accents and some callers getting angry when challenged. The number rings repeatedly, sometimes nonstop, and is often blocked by recipients who describe it as spam. Despite occasional attempts to seem legitimate, the feedback suggests high suspicion and annoyance from those contacted.

About 01 Numbers
These numbers are connected to specific locations in the UK and are commonly used by both residences and businesses. Often called as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the call costs for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. A good number of service providers offer call packages that allow free calls during specified times. Call costs from mobile phones are according to the chosen calling plan, with a lot of plans providing these numbers in their free call packages.
